Made a card for the confirmation student that we mentor at church and decided to try this week's technique challenge to make a little treat container to go with it.
Kept the card pretty simple... A punched border, some nesties for the large sentiment and punches for the smaller sentiment. Popped up a bunch of hearts on the container, added a tag, managed to save enough chocolates to put in the package and it was done. Great little template for the container - easy, peasy. Thanks for the challege idea!
The paper is from a digital kit called "Prints Charming Collection" found at nitwitcollections.com.

Stamps: Inkadinkadoo Good News set and Mike's $1.50 sentiment
Paper: GP white, Real Red
Ink: Versafine Onyx Black, Real Red for sponging
Accessories: MS Floral Vine Deep Edge border punch, SU: Heart to Heart, Modern Label, Word Window, Scalloped Circle and Lg/Small tag punches, Scalloped circle nesties
Techniques: Bucket handbag template by Mel (stampztoomuch)
